What is GitHub Copilot?
GitHub Copilot is the world's most widely adopted AI developer tool, used by millions of developers to write code faster and with greater confidence. Powered by OpenAI's models and deeply integrated into the GitHub ecosystem, Copilot provides intelligent code completions, chat-based coding assistance, pull request summaries, and security vulnerability detection. It supports all major programming languages and integrates with VS Code, JetBrains, Neovim, and the GitHub web interface. GitHub Copilot has fundamentally changed how developers write code, with studies showing it helps developers complete tasks up to 55% faster.

Frequently Asked Questions about GitHub Copilot
What is GitHub Copilot?
GitHub Copilot is the most widely adopted AI coding assistant, providing code completions, chat, and PR assistance.
How much does GitHub Copilot cost?
Individual: $10/month. Business: $19/user/month. Enterprise: $39/user/month. Free for students and open source.
What IDEs does Copilot support?
VS Code, JetBrains IDEs, Neovim, Visual Studio, and the GitHub web interface.
Is Copilot good for beginners?
Yes, Copilot helps beginners learn by suggesting code patterns and explaining concepts through Copilot Chat.
Does Copilot work offline?
No, Copilot requires an internet connection as suggestions are generated in the cloud.
